WHAT’S IT ABOUT?
Throughout the 20th century, Polish scientist Marie Sklodowska-Curie (Pike) and her husband Pierre Curie (Riley) make several scientific breakthroughs, including the discovery of radioactivity which throws them into the limelight and changes the nature of science forever…
